Meet Riley, the 'super sweet' rescue dog waiting to meet his match and find a forever home.

This four-year-old Lurcher is a smash hit with staff at Dogs Trust Darlington, who describe Riley as a loving, playful and loyal boy once he gets to know you. This chap loves a tennis ball and showing off his enviable ball skills.

His impressive moves have not gone unnoticed by his Dogs Trust carers, who say he keenly chases every ball and has the energy of any elite athlete when it comes to playing. But he also loves snuggling up in a duvet.

Riley lacks confidence in life and can find new situations overwhelming. He is sociable with other dogs and enjoys having walking friends but will need to be the only pooch in the home. He would also be best suited to an adult only home, living with a maximum of two people who are willing to carry on his training. Few visitors to the home would be ideal for Riley as he does prefer a calm environment.

Riley will need to have his family around for him initially to help him settle into his new life and build up any leaving hours gradually over time.

The team at Dogs Trust Darlington hope it will soon be Game, Set and Match for this beautiful lad as he bounds off to his forever home. More information is available about Riley here.
